•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

sds / haml-lint / 27999845679
97%

Build:
DEFAULT BRANCH: main
Ran 23 Jun 2026 03:22AM UTC
Jobs 48
Files 101
Run time 1min
Badge
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

23 Jun 2026 03:20AM UTC coverage: 97.378%. Remained the same
27999845679

push

github

web-flow
docs: clarify how to disable a forced RuboCop cop for HAML files (#660)

* docs: clarify how to disable a forced RuboCop cop for HAML files

`Enabled: false` in .rubocop.yml has no effect on forced cops (e.g.
Layout/CaseIndentation); document `ignored_cops` as the way to disable
them. Fixes the `ignored_cop` typo in the README. Refs #407.

* docs: add dedicated RuboCop integration page; document Rails false positives

Move the RuboCop documentation out of the linter catalog into a dedicated
lib/haml_lint/linter/RuboCop.md page (the catalog entry becomes a short stub
linking to it), and document known false positives with Rails/* cops in views:

* Rails/FindEach suggests find_each on a relation that was already ordered
  elsewhere, silently dropping the order
* Rails/HttpStatus treats a partial's `status:` keyword as an HTTP status code

Both are reproducible with rubocop-rails loaded; the recommended fix is to
disable the cop for HAML via `ignored_cops` or a `.rubocop.yml` Exclude.

Closes #488. Refs #443.

---------

Co-authored-by: Shane da Silva <shane@dasilva.io>

3008 of 3089 relevant lines covered (97.38%)

30815.07 hits per line

Jobs
ID Job ID Ran Files Coverage
1 ruby4.0-haml7.1-ubuntu - 27999845679.1 23 Jun 2026 03:23AM UTC 202
97.02
GitHub Action Run
2 ruby3.3-haml7.2-ubuntu - 27999845679.2 23 Jun 2026 03:26AM UTC 202
97.02
GitHub Action Run
3 ruby3.4-haml6.0-ubuntu - 27999845679.3 23 Jun 2026 03:26AM UTC 202
96.99
GitHub Action Run
4 ruby3.2-haml7.2-ubuntu - 27999845679.4 23 Jun 2026 03:23AM UTC 202
97.02
GitHub Action Run
5 ruby4.0-haml7.2-ubuntu - 27999845679.5 23 Jun 2026 03:23AM UTC 202
97.02
GitHub Action Run
6 ruby4.0-haml6.0-ubuntu - 27999845679.6 23 Jun 2026 03:26AM UTC 202
96.99
GitHub Action Run
7 ruby3.4-rubocop1.0-ubuntu - 27999845679.7 23 Jun 2026 03:25AM UTC 202
96.99
GitHub Action Run
8 ruby3.4-haml5.2-ubuntu - 27999845679.8 23 Jun 2026 03:25AM UTC 202
96.73
GitHub Action Run
9 ruby3.4-haml6.4-ubuntu - 27999845679.9 23 Jun 2026 03:25AM UTC 202
96.99
GitHub Action Run
10 ruby3.3-haml6.4-ubuntu - 27999845679.10 23 Jun 2026 03:25AM UTC 202
96.98
GitHub Action Run
11 ruby3.3-haml5.1-ubuntu - 27999845679.11 23 Jun 2026 03:26AM UTC 202
96.98
GitHub Action Run
12 ruby3.3-haml6.3-ubuntu - 27999845679.12 23 Jun 2026 03:23AM UTC 202
96.98
GitHub Action Run
13 ruby3.2-haml7.1-ubuntu - 27999845679.13 23 Jun 2026 03:26AM UTC 202
97.02
GitHub Action Run
14 ruby3.4-haml7.1-ubuntu - 27999845679.14 23 Jun 2026 03:26AM UTC 202
97.02
GitHub Action Run
15 ruby3.3-haml5.0-ubuntu - 27999845679.15 23 Jun 2026 03:26AM UTC 202
96.98
GitHub Action Run
16 ruby3.3-rubocop1.0-ubuntu - 27999845679.16 23 Jun 2026 03:23AM UTC 202
96.98
GitHub Action Run
17 ruby3.3-haml6.2-ubuntu - 27999845679.17 23 Jun 2026 03:25AM UTC 202
96.98
GitHub Action Run
18 ruby3.4-haml6.1-ubuntu - 27999845679.18 23 Jun 2026 03:25AM UTC 202
96.99
GitHub Action Run
19 ruby3.4-haml6.2-ubuntu - 27999845679.19 23 Jun 2026 03:24AM UTC 202
96.99
GitHub Action Run
20 ruby3.4-haml6.3-ubuntu - 27999845679.20 23 Jun 2026 03:26AM UTC 202
96.99
GitHub Action Run
21 ruby4.0-haml6.4-ubuntu - 27999845679.21 23 Jun 2026 03:26AM UTC 202
96.99
GitHub Action Run
22 ruby3.4-haml5.1-ubuntu - 27999845679.22 23 Jun 2026 03:22AM UTC 202
96.99
GitHub Action Run
23 ruby3.2-haml6.4-ubuntu - 27999845679.23 23 Jun 2026 03:23AM UTC 202
96.98
GitHub Action Run
24 ruby3.2-rubocop1.0-ubuntu - 27999845679.24 23 Jun 2026 03:25AM UTC 202
96.98
GitHub Action Run
25 ruby4.0-haml6.3-ubuntu - 27999845679.25 23 Jun 2026 03:26AM UTC 202
96.99
GitHub Action Run
26 ruby3.2-haml5.0-ubuntu - 27999845679.26 23 Jun 2026 03:26AM UTC 202
96.98
GitHub Action Run
27 ruby4.0-rubocop1.0-ubuntu - 27999845679.27 23 Jun 2026 03:25AM UTC 202
96.99
GitHub Action Run
28 ruby3.4-haml7.0-ubuntu - 27999845679.28 23 Jun 2026 03:26AM UTC 202
97.02
GitHub Action Run
29 ruby4.0-haml6.1-ubuntu - 27999845679.29 23 Jun 2026 03:25AM UTC 202
96.99
GitHub Action Run
30 ruby3.2-haml5.2-ubuntu - 27999845679.30 23 Jun 2026 03:23AM UTC 202
96.73
GitHub Action Run
31 ruby3.2-haml6.0-ubuntu - 27999845679.31 23 Jun 2026 03:25AM UTC 202
96.98
GitHub Action Run
32 ruby3.3-haml7.0-ubuntu - 27999845679.32 23 Jun 2026 03:22AM UTC 202
97.02
GitHub Action Run
33 ruby4.0-haml5.1-ubuntu - 27999845679.33 23 Jun 2026 03:25AM UTC 202
96.99
GitHub Action Run
34 ruby4.0-haml6.2-ubuntu - 27999845679.34 23 Jun 2026 03:26AM UTC 202
96.99
GitHub Action Run
35 ruby3.2-haml6.2-ubuntu - 27999845679.35 23 Jun 2026 03:23AM UTC 202
96.98
GitHub Action Run
36 ruby4.0-haml5.0-ubuntu - 27999845679.36 23 Jun 2026 03:26AM UTC 202
96.99
GitHub Action Run
37 ruby3.3-haml5.2-ubuntu - 27999845679.37 23 Jun 2026 03:26AM UTC 202
96.73
GitHub Action Run
38 ruby3.3-haml6.1-ubuntu - 27999845679.38 23 Jun 2026 03:23AM UTC 202
96.98
GitHub Action Run
39 ruby3.2-haml6.3-ubuntu - 27999845679.39 23 Jun 2026 03:23AM UTC 202
96.98
GitHub Action Run
40 ruby4.0-haml7.0-ubuntu - 27999845679.40 23 Jun 2026 03:25AM UTC 202
97.02
GitHub Action Run
41 ruby3.4-haml7.2-ubuntu - 27999845679.41 23 Jun 2026 03:26AM UTC 202
97.02
GitHub Action Run
42 ruby3.4-haml5.0-ubuntu - 27999845679.42 23 Jun 2026 03:25AM UTC 202
96.99
GitHub Action Run
43 ruby3.3-haml6.0-ubuntu - 27999845679.43 23 Jun 2026 03:26AM UTC 202
96.98
GitHub Action Run
44 ruby3.2-haml7.0-ubuntu - 27999845679.44 23 Jun 2026 03:24AM UTC 202
97.02
GitHub Action Run
45 ruby3.2-haml5.1-ubuntu - 27999845679.45 23 Jun 2026 03:23AM UTC 202
96.98
GitHub Action Run
46 ruby4.0-haml5.2-ubuntu - 27999845679.46 23 Jun 2026 03:25AM UTC 202
96.73
GitHub Action Run
47 ruby3.3-haml7.1-ubuntu - 27999845679.47 23 Jun 2026 03:24AM UTC 202
97.02
GitHub Action Run
48 ruby3.2-haml6.1-ubuntu - 27999845679.48 23 Jun 2026 03:26AM UTC 202
96.98
GitHub Action Run
Source Files on build 27999845679
  • Tree
  • List 101
  • Changed 100
  • Source Changed 0
  • Coverage Changed 100
Coverage ∆ File Lines Relevant Covered Missed Hits/Line
  • Back to Repo
  • Github Actions Build #27999845679
  • e8e030f1 on github
  • Prev Build on main (#27999771930)
  • Next Build on main (#28000062110)
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2026 Coveralls, Inc